Employers seek TEFL teachers who possess the necessary qualifications and certifications to excel in the field. A Bachelor's degree, preferably in English or Education, is often a minimum requirement. Additionally, a TEFL, TESOL, or CELTA certification is highly valued as it demonstrates a solid foundation in teaching English as a foreign language. These certifications ensure that teachers are equipped with the essential skills and knowledge needed to effectively teach English to non-native speakers. Having relevant teaching experience can significantly impact an employer's decision when hiring TEFL teachers. Providing feedback to English language learners is crucial for their language development. Feedback helps students understand their strengths and weaknesses, identify areas for improvement, and track their progress over time. It also motivates learners by recognizing their efforts and achievements. Constructive feedback can boost students' confidence and encourage them to continue learning and improving their language skills. There are several effective strategies for providing feedback to English language learners. One key strategy is to make feedback specific and actionable. Instead of simply saying "good job," provide specific examples of what the student did well and areas where they can improve. Another important strategy is to give feedback in a timely manner. Dave's ESL Cafe is one of the oldest and most reputable TEFL job boards, serving as a go-to platform for teachers looking for international teaching positions. The website features job postings from various countries, along with resources such as teacher forums, lesson plans, and tips for living abroad. Teaching pronunciation to English language learners is crucial for effective communication. Pronunciation impacts how well a learner is understood and how confident they feel when speaking. It also plays a significant role in listening comprehension. Without clear pronunciation, miscommunication can occur, leading to frustration and misunderstanding. Therefore, focusing on pronunciation from the beginning stages of language learning is essential. When teaching pronunciation, it is important to incorporate a variety of techniques to cater to different learning styles. Assessing English language proficiency in students is crucial for tracking their progress, identifying areas for improvement, and providing targeted support. It is essential to use a variety of assessment methods to gain a comprehensive understanding of students' language skills. Assessments should be fair, valid, reliable, and aligned with learning objectives to ensure accurate results. There are various types of assessments that can be used to measure English language proficiency in students. These include standardized tests like the TOEFL and IELTS, proficiency interviews, portfolio assessments, self-assessments, and teacher-created assessments. In a classroom setting where English is being taught as a foreign language, language barriers can pose significant challenges for both the students and the teacher. These barriers can manifest in various forms, such as limited vocabulary, incorrect grammar usage, pronunciation difficulties, and cultural differences. Understanding the root causes of these barriers is crucial in developing effective strategies to address them. There are several strategies that teachers can employ to address language barriers in the classroom. One effective approach is to use visual aids and realia to enhance understanding. Visual aids such as pictures, charts, and graphs can help clarify concepts and make the lesson more engaging for students. Language exchange programs are a fantastic way for students to practice their English skills in a real-world setting. These programs typically pair learners with native speakers who are looking to learn the student's native language. This reciprocal arrangement allows for authentic language practice in a relaxed and informal environment. Students can engage in conversations, cultural exchanges, and language activities, which can significantly enhance their language skills. Many language exchange programs are available online and in-person, providing students with a variety of options to choose from.
